Steps to Take After a Nashville Truck Accident

Even if you live in another state, there are important actions to take immediately after a truck collision:

  1. Seek medical care to document injuries and create a record of treatment.
  2. Report the accident to your insurance company while avoiding recorded statements that could harm your claim.

Common Causes of Nashville Truck Accidents

Understanding the leading factors behind truck collisions highlights why legal representation is crucial:

  • Driver fatigue or distraction
  • Overloaded or improperly secured cargo
  • Defective truck parts or poor maintenance
  • Reckless driving or speeding

Statute of Limitations in Tennessee

Tennessee law typically gives accident victims one year from the date of the crash to file a personal injury lawsuit. Missing this deadline can forfeit your right to compensation. By hiring a Nashville truck lawyer promptly, you ensure critical evidence is preserved and your case is filed on time.
